The female body shows regular changes under the influence of growth hormone. Each menstrual cycle can be divided into physiological period, ovulation period and safe menstrual period. Generally speaking, for women with normal menstrual cycles, 14 days before the first day of menstruation is the ovulation period. The 5 days before and 4 days after ovulation, plus the day of ovulation, a total of 10 days, is the ovulation period. Life outside the ovulation period and menstrual period is called the safe menstruation period. The safe period after ovulation is safer than the safe period before ovulation.

The female body undergoes regular changes due to the influence of growth hormone

For example, taking the menstrual cycle of 30 days as an example, the first day of menarche this time is September 15th, then the next menarche will be on October 15th (September 15th plus 30 days), and then subtract 14 days from October 15th, then October 1st is the ovulation period. The ovulation period, the 5 days before and the 4 days after, that is, the ten days from September 26 to October 5 are the ovulation period.

However, we need to remind everyone that to use this method to calculate the ovulation period, we must first understand the length of the menstrual cycle. In other words, we must have a very normal or regular menstrual cycle to calculate the ovulation period. Therefore, it is only suitable for women whose menstrual cycles are always normal.

What should you pay attention to during ovulation?

1. Have your own special cotton towel and use flowing water to clean private parts when taking a shower.

2. After each defecation, it is best to develop the habit of washing with warm water to prevent intestinal bacteria from entering the vagina and causing inflammation.

3. You must drink enough water every day to reduce the bacteria that grow in the urethra.

4. It should be noted that when you have a lot of secretions, you can use a hair dryer set to warm air to dry your private parts after taking a shower. After taking a shower, you should wear underwear after your private parts are relatively dry. Nowadays, many people only wear skirts without underwear at home, or do not wear underwear when sleeping at night. This is better for the private parts, as it allows it to have a chance to ventilate and dry. But bedding should be changed frequently to keep it clean.

5. Be careful when choosing daily necessities, and use less sanitary napkins and handkerchiefs containing spices, colorants or deodorizing ingredients. In addition, there is no need to use soapy water or shower gel to clean the vagina, because most of the general shower gels and soaps are alkaline, with a pH value above 7, which will easily destroy the weakly acidic environment and cause gynecological diseases.

6. It is best to wear cotton underwear that is absorbent and breathable. In hot seasons, it is best not to wear tights. When sitting in public places, try not to wear miniskirts to avoid letting your underwear touch the seat.

7. Underwear should be cleaned separately from other clothes and cleaned with a mild detergent. Some descaling agents or softeners may cause allergic symptoms. If you feel something is wrong, it is best not to use them.
